Meaning of veterinarian

A veterinarian is a medical professional who specializes in the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of diseases and injuries in animals.

Key Difference

While 'veterinarian' is the formal term for an animal doctor, its synonyms may vary in context, specialization, or regional usage.

Example of veterinarian

  • The veterinarian carefully examined the injured dog and prescribed antibiotics.
  • After years of study, Maria became a licensed veterinarian and opened her own clinic.

Synonyms

vet 🔊

Meaning of vet

A shortened informal term for a veterinarian.

Key Difference

'Vet' is more casual and commonly used in everyday conversation, whereas 'veterinarian' is the formal title.

Example of vet

  • I took my cat to the vet for her annual checkup.
  • The vet advised me to change my dog’s diet for better health.

veterinary surgeon 🔊

Meaning of veterinary surgeon

A veterinarian who performs surgical procedures on animals.

Key Difference

A 'veterinary surgeon' specifically focuses on surgeries, while a general veterinarian may not specialize in surgical procedures.

Example of veterinary surgeon

  • The veterinary surgeon successfully operated on the racehorse’s fractured leg.
  • After the accident, the rabbit needed immediate attention from a veterinary surgeon.

wildlife veterinarian 🔊

Meaning of wildlife veterinarian

A veterinarian who treats wild animals, often in conservation or rehabilitation settings.

Key Difference

A 'wildlife veterinarian' works with wild species, unlike general veterinarians who mostly treat domestic animals.

Example of wildlife veterinarian

  • The wildlife veterinarian rescued an eagle with a broken wing.
  • National parks often employ wildlife veterinarians to monitor animal health.
